Visa Stream

Description

Application Location

Government Agreement

Allows individuals to come to Australia based on the terms and conditions of a bilateral agreement between the Australian Government or an Australian state or territory government and the government of another country.

Inside or Outside Australia

Foreign Government Agency

Intended for representatives of foreign governments who will not be given official status in Australia by the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(DFAT), or individuals employed as foreign language teachers by foreign governments in Australian schools.

Inside or Outside Australia

Domestic Worker (Diplomatic or Consular)

Enables individuals to engage in domestic work in the household of someone holding a Diplomatic (Temporary) visa (subclass 995).

Inside or Outside Australia

Privileges and Immunities

Designed for individuals with privileges and immunities under the International Organisations (Privileges and Immunities) Act 1963 or the Overseas Missions (Privileges and Immunities) Act 1995.

Inside or Outside Australia

Seasonal Worker Program

Allows individuals to come to Australia and work as seasonal laborers in selected industries for Australian employers who cannot source local labor. Participation in the Seasonal Worker Program requires an invitation from an approved Temporary Activities sponsor. This stream is limited to selected countries and can only be applied for and granted outside Australia.

Outside Australia

Requirements to Employ a Domestic Worker Under This Visa

Hold a Diplomatic visa (subclass 995)

Accreditation as a diplomat or consular officer in Australia

Not being a permanent resident of Australia

Formal support from the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(DFAT) before the worker applies for their visa

Intention to employ the worker for domestic duties in your private household

Signing an employment contract in accordance with Australian workplace conditions, as well as applicable state and territory legislation

The Fair Work Ombudsman provides information and advice on workplace rights, conditions, and employer obligations

To participate in the Seasonal Worker Programme, the sponsor must be an authorized employer seeking to recruit seasonal workers for industries such as horticulture, tourism (accommodation), aquaculture, sugar cane, and cotton.

To qualify as a sponsor, your organization must be legally established and actively operating within Australia. Moreover:

You must be an Australian organization or a government agency.

There should be no negative information associated with your organization, or if such information exists, it must be reasonable to disregard it.

If your organization has previously sponsored foreign workers to come to Australia, you must have a satisfactory track record of compliance with Australian laws.
